WebThe RGD-modified NaLuF4nanocrystals have been used for UCL-targeted cell imaging in U87MG tumor cells. The results demonstrate that RGD modification yields NaLuF4UCNPs suitable for UCL-targeted cell imaging under excitation at 980 nm, owing to the high and specific affinity between RGD and αvβ3integrin.
